package org.apache.ode.store;
import java.io.File;
import java.net.URI;
import java.util.Collection;
import java.util.EnumSet;
import java.util.List;
import javax.xml.namespace.QName;
import junit.framework.TestCase;
import org.apache.ode.bpel.iapi.ProcessConf;
import org.apache.ode.bpel.iapi.ProcessConf.CLEANUP_CATEGORY;
public class ProcessStoreTest extends TestCase {
ProcessStoreImpl _ps;
private File _testdd;
public void setUp() throws Exception {
System.setProperty("openjpa.properties", "/openjpa.xml");
_ps = new ProcessStoreImpl();
_ps.loadAll();
URI tdd= getClass().getResource("/testdd/deploy.xml").toURI();
_testdd = new File(tdd.getPath()).getParentFile();
}
public void tearDown() throws Exception {
_ps.shutdown();
}
public void testSanity() {
assertEquals(0,_ps.getProcesses().size());
assertEquals(0,_ps.getPackages().size());
assertNull(_ps.listProcesses("foobar"));
}
public void testDeploy() {
Collection<QName> deployed = _ps.deploy(_testdd);
assertNotNull(deployed);
assertEquals(1,deployed.size());
}
public void testGetProcess() {
Collection<QName> deployed = _ps.deploy(_testdd);
QName pname = deployed.iterator().next();
assertNotNull(deployed);
assertEquals(1,deployed.size());
ProcessConf pconf = _ps.getProcessConfiguration(pname);
assertNotNull(pconf);
assertEquals(_testdd.getName(),pconf.getPackage());
assertEquals(pname, pconf.getProcessId());
}
public void testGetProcesses() {
Collection<QName> deployed = _ps.deploy(_testdd);
QName pname = deployed.iterator().next();
assertNotNull(deployed);
assertEquals(1,deployed.size());
List<QName> pconfs = _ps.getProcesses();
assertEquals(pname,pconfs.get(0));
}
public void testCleanupConfigurations() {
Collection<QName> deployed = _ps.deploy(_testdd);
QName pname = deployed.iterator().next();
assertNotNull(deployed);
assertEquals(1,deployed.size());
ProcessConf pconf = _ps.getProcessConfiguration(pname);
assertNotNull(pconf);
assertEquals(_testdd.getName(),pconf.getPackage());
assertEquals(pname, pconf.getProcessId());
assertEquals(EnumSet.allOf(CLEANUP_CATEGORY.class), pconf.getCleanupCategories(true));
assertEquals(EnumSet.of(CLEANUP_CATEGORY.MESSAGES, CLEANUP_CATEGORY.EVENTS), pconf.getCleanupCategories(false));
assertTrue(pconf.isCleanupCategoryEnabled(true, CLEANUP_CATEGORY.INSTANCE));
assertTrue(pconf.isCleanupCategoryEnabled(true, CLEANUP_CATEGORY.VARIABLES));
assertTrue(pconf.isCleanupCategoryEnabled(true, CLEANUP_CATEGORY.MESSAGES));
assertTrue(pconf.isCleanupCategoryEnabled(true, CLEANUP_CATEGORY.CORRELATIONS));
assertTrue(pconf.isCleanupCategoryEnabled(true, CLEANUP_CATEGORY.EVENTS));
assertFalse(pconf.isCleanupCategoryEnabled(false, CLEANUP_CATEGORY.INSTANCE));
assertFalse(pconf.isCleanupCategoryEnabled(false, CLEANUP_CATEGORY.VARIABLES));
assertTrue(pconf.isCleanupCategoryEnabled(false, CLEANUP_CATEGORY.MESSAGES));
assertFalse(pconf.isCleanupCategoryEnabled(false, CLEANUP_CATEGORY.CORRELATIONS));
assertTrue(pconf.isCleanupCategoryEnabled(false, CLEANUP_CATEGORY.EVENTS));
}
}
